9 9 Case 1: Energy Efficiency Dos Pinos – Cooperative Diary Industry Diary Industry Cheese and dehydrated milk plant Cheese and dehydrated milk plant Implemented measures: Fuels: Fuels:  7.5% reduction in Fuel Oil consumption for boilers  43 872 Liters/year  US $9 730 / year  127.93 Tons CO 2  Estimated Investment US$5 000  Return of Investment: 0,51 years

11 11 Case 2: Material substitution Equipos El Prado Metal processing Metal processing Before CP-IPA it was used Cr +VI (water pollutant, toxic and carcinogenic) Now the use Cr III (Cr IV free). Benefits: only –They eliminate the use of the only carcinogenic substance of the process –Reduction in water treatment costs –Increase in production costs of only 7%. –Product quality is the same and is accepted by the companies
